Backport r69961 to trunk, replacing JUMP_IF_{TRUE,FALSE} with
POP_JUMP_IF_{TRUE,FALSE} and JUMP_IF_{TRUE,FALSE}_OR_POP. This avoids executing
a POP_TOP on each conditional and sometimes allows the peephole optimizer to
skip a JUMP_ABSOLUTE entirely. It speeds up list comprehensions significantly.
